A Voice for All Labor
The United Labor of America is a fresh, independent labor organization founded to stand up for every American worker — white-collar and blue-collar. We fight for workers’ rights, a living wage, affordable healthcare, and equal rights for all people regardless of color, race, sex, or income. We support human rights.
We believe corporations can make money — but not all the money. Profits should be shared with the employees who create them, and prices cut for consumers rather than funneled to Wall Street shareholders.
We are a private LLC small business that pays taxes — not a non-profit. Fully transparent: all accounting available to the public quarterly.

The ULA Platform
Concrete policy positions that put workers first — always.
$20 Federal Living Wage
A $20/hr federal minimum with automatic cost-of-living increases — for every worker, no exceptions.
4-Day, 36-Hour Workweek
Fewer hours without reduced pay. Workers deserve time for family, health, and life outside of work.
Equal Pay, Part & Full Time
Same hourly rate and full benefits for part-time employees — same work, same pay.
Retire at 60 w/ Medicare
Lower the retirement age to 60 with full Medicare benefits. Workers who built America deserve to rest.
No Tax on Social Security
Americans who worked their whole lives shouldn’t be taxed on benefits they earned.
Worker & Environmental Safety
Environmental protections and job safety standards for every worker in every industry.
Food Service Living Wage
Food service workers paid a living wage first — tips are a bonus, not a substitute for fair pay.
Global Living Wage
Countries that don’t pay living wages face tariffs to level the playing field for American workers.
Veterans Jobs & Training
Dedicated job listings, training programs, and career resources for those who served.
Immigration Worker Support
Supporting immigration workers who have a sponsor providing food, healthcare, and shelter for their family.
Paid Vacation Rights
One week paid vacation after year one, plus an additional week for every 5 years with the same employer.
Small Business Work Comp
Tax deduction for workers’ comp insurance for small businesses — protecting workers without crushing owners.
